当前位置:首页 > 技术 >

c语言与c语言的关系(c语言与编程语言的区别)

来源:原点资讯(www.yd166.com)时间:2022-11-22 17:02:59作者:YD166手机阅读>>

文章下方附学习资源,自助领取

c语言入门程序Hello World

#include<stdio.h> int main() { /*在双引号中间输入Hello World*/ printf("Hello World"); //在屏幕打印输出Hello World return 0; }

注:在最新的C标准中,main函数前的类型为int而不是void

C语言的具体结构

简单来说,一个C程序就是由若干头文件和函数组成。

c语言与c语言的关系,c语言与编程语言的区别(1)

#include <stdio.h>就是一条预处理命令, 它的作用是通知C语言编译系统在对C程序进行正式编译之前需做一些预处理工作。

函数就是实现代码逻辑的一个小的单元。

必不可少之主函数

一个C程序有且只有一个主函数,即main函数。

c语言与c语言的关系,c语言与编程语言的区别(2)

  • C程序就是执行主函数里的代码,也可以说这个主函数就是C语言中的唯一入口
  • 而main前面的int就是主函数的类型
  • printf()是格式输出函数,这里就记住它的功能就是在屏幕上输出指定的信息
  • return是函数的返回值,根据函数类型的不同,返回的值也是不同的
  • \n是转义字符中的换行符。(注意:C程序一定是从主函数开始执行的)

写代码的良好习惯

  • 一个说明或一个语句占一行,例如:包含头文件、一个可执行语句结束都需要换行
  • 函数体内的语句要有明显缩进,通常以按一下Tab键为一个缩进
  • 括号要成对写,如果需要删除的话也要成对删除
  • 当一句可执行语句结束的时候末尾需要有分号
  • 代码中所有符号均为英文半角符号

c语言与c语言的关系,c语言与编程语言的区别(3)

程序解释——注释

注释是写给程序员看的,不是写给电脑看的。

C语言注释方法有两种:

多行注释:/* 注释内容 */ 单行注释://注释一行

C标识符

C语言规定,标识符可以是字母(A~Z,a~z)、数字(0~9)、下划线_组成的字符串,并且第一个字符必须是字母或下划线。在使用标识符时还有注意以下几点:

  • 标识符的长度最好不要超过8位,因为在某些版本的C中规定标识符前8位有效,当两个标识符前8位相同时,则被认为是同一个标识符
  • 标识符是严格区分大小写的。例如Imooc和imooc 是两个不同的标识符
  • 标识符最好选择有意义的英文单词组成做到"见名知意",不要使用中文
  • 标识符不能是C语言的关键字。想了解更多C语言关键字的知识

变量定义与赋值

变量就是可以变化的量,而每个变量都会有一个名字(标识符)。变量占据内存中一定的存储单元。使用变量之前必须先定义变量,要区分变量名和变量值是两个不同的概念。

c语言与c语言的关系,c语言与编程语言的区别(4)

栏目热文

海底椰煲汤小孩能吃吗(海底椰与什么搭配煲汤小孩咳嗽喝)

海底椰煲汤小孩能吃吗(海底椰与什么搭配煲汤小孩咳嗽喝)

天气越来越热了,很多地方都开启了夏日模式,在与孩子享受夏日欢乐的同时,也给大家提个醒,那就是不要忽视夏季咳嗽的问题哦。儿...

2022-11-22 16:45:33查看全文 >>

响螺片海底椰煲汤的做法大全(海底椰响螺片煲鸡汤做法与功效)

响螺片海底椰煲汤的做法大全(海底椰响螺片煲鸡汤做法与功效)

《黄帝内经》认为“秋冬养阴”。所谓秋冬养阴,是指在秋冬养收气、养藏气,不应耗精而伤阴气,从而为来年阳气生发打好基础。响螺...

2022-11-22 16:46:26查看全文 >>

海底椰响螺肉煲鸡汤的做法(椰子响螺煲鸡汤的做法)

海底椰响螺肉煲鸡汤的做法(椰子响螺煲鸡汤的做法)

本期的粉丝靓菜是来自佛山的“馒头”。她说自己是一枚忙碌的金融民工,同时也是一名喜欢捣鼓食材的师奶,真的是非常幽默。我们一...

2022-11-22 16:54:05查看全文 >>

海底椰响螺详细做法(响螺海底椰详细做法)

海底椰响螺详细做法(响螺海底椰详细做法)

说到海底椰可能比较常煲汤的朋友就会比较熟悉了,海椰子坚果内的果汁稠浓至胶状,味道香醇,可食亦可酿酒,海椰子果肉细白,美味...

2022-11-22 16:49:50查看全文 >>

海底椰响螺片汤的做法(干响螺片海底椰干煲汤的做法)

海底椰响螺片汤的做法(干响螺片海底椰干煲汤的做法)

  今天教大家制作【海底椰响螺虫草汤】,这道汤鲜而不腻,入喉清润,能够清热防燥、润肺止咳,增强体质,做法方便,健康美味,...

2022-11-22 17:05:15查看全文 >>

c语言和高级语言(c语言与高级语言的关系)

c语言和高级语言(c语言与高级语言的关系)

本文转自公众号“CSDN”,ID:CSDNnews)作者 | Serdar Yegulalp 译者 | 王艳妮,责编 |...

2022-11-22 17:12:56查看全文 >>

先学c语言和c+语言(c语言学好了才能学c+语言)

先学c语言和c+语言(c语言学好了才能学c+语言)

写之前先来回答几个问题1、C 后台开发有哪些岗位?C 后台开发的岗位还是很多的,例如游戏引擎开发,游戏服务端开发...

2022-11-22 16:59:15查看全文 >>

c语言和软件技术(c语言程序详细教程)

c语言和软件技术(c语言程序详细教程)

这都是作为程序员的基本技能,将长期伴随你的程序员职业生涯。如果你的目标是从事软件开发和编程工作,那么这些都是保持竞争力可...

2022-11-22 16:41:25查看全文 >>

c 语言怎么用(c语言编程在哪里使用)

c 语言怎么用(c语言编程在哪里使用)

引出C语言教程开篇,小编想先谈一谈,c语言的地位。翻了翻,百度,知乎,这些编程领域,被问的最多的便是 “某某语言和某某语...

2022-11-22 17:11:10查看全文 >>

c语言和c语言(c语言与编程语言的区别)

c语言和c语言(c语言与编程语言的区别)

关于C语言的那些小知识,准备学习或者刚刚入门的你已经了解了吗?语言种类编译语言静态声明语言面向过程的编程语言环境工具编译...

2022-11-22 16:34:05查看全文 >>

文档排行